Phang Nga Town's Secret Food Quarter
- Auntie Nim's Gaeng Som – A 40-year-old stall serving the most authentic southern Thai sour curry
- Uncle Chai's Moo Ping – Grilled pork skewers with a secret marinade recipe
- Grandma Siri's Kanom Jeen – Fresh rice noodles with three different curry options
Must-Try Vendors
Best Time: 6–10 PM when locals finish work
Location: Behind the old market area, near Wat Tham Suwan Khuha
The Dawn Market (Talat Chao)
- Khao Kriab – Steamed rice flour dumplings with coconut and pork filling
- Coffee Uncle's Thai Coffee – Traditional coffee served with homemade condensed milk
- Fresh Coconut Pancakes – Made to order with local coconut and palm sugar
Hidden Specialties
Best Time: 4:30–8:00 AM daily
Location: Phang Nga Town center, near the old bus station
